Understanding the Basics of Lawn Fertilizers

Before diving into specific product recommendations, it’s essential to understand the fundamental components of lawn fertilizers and how they impact grass growth. Fertilizers are primarily composed of three macronutrients: nitrogen (N), phosphorus (P), and potassium (K). These nutrients are represented by a three-number sequence on fertilizer packaging, such as 10-10-10 or 20-5-10. This sequence is known as the NPK ratio.

Nitrogen is the driving force behind lush, green growth. It promotes leaf development and overall plant vigor. Think of it as the fuel that powers your lawn’s engine.

Phosphorus is crucial for root development, especially in young or newly seeded lawns. It aids in establishing a strong root system that can withstand stress and absorb nutrients efficiently.

Potassium plays a vital role in the overall health and resilience of your lawn. It enhances disease resistance, drought tolerance, and the ability to withstand temperature fluctuations. It acts as a general health booster for your grass.

Beyond macronutrients, some fertilizers also contain micronutrients like iron, manganese, and zinc. These micronutrients contribute to specific aspects of lawn health, such as color and disease resistance. Iron, for example, is well-known for its ability to deepen the green color of grass.

Choosing the Right NPK Ratio for Spring

Selecting the correct NPK ratio is paramount for spring fertilization. While a balanced fertilizer (e.g., 10-10-10) can be suitable in some cases, a fertilizer with a higher nitrogen content is generally recommended for spring. This is because nitrogen is essential for promoting rapid growth and greening up the lawn after winter dormancy.

A fertilizer with an NPK ratio of 20-5-10 or 24-0-4 is often an excellent choice for spring. The higher nitrogen content will stimulate leaf growth and create a vibrant green appearance. The lower phosphorus content is generally adequate for established lawns, as excessive phosphorus can contribute to environmental problems. The potassium helps to improve overall lawn health and resilience.

Consider a soil test before making your final decision. A soil test will reveal the specific nutrient deficiencies in your soil, allowing you to choose a fertilizer that addresses those deficiencies directly. You can obtain a soil test kit from your local garden center or agricultural extension office. Follow the instructions carefully to collect a representative soil sample and send it to a laboratory for analysis. The results will provide valuable insights into your soil’s composition and nutrient levels.

Types of Lawn Fertilizers

Lawn fertilizers come in various forms, each with its own advantages and disadvantages. Understanding these differences will help you choose the best option for your needs and preferences.

Slow-release fertilizers gradually release nutrients over an extended period, typically several weeks or months. This provides a consistent supply of nutrients to the lawn, reducing the risk of burning and minimizing the need for frequent applications. Slow-release fertilizers are often more expensive than quick-release fertilizers, but they offer a more convenient and sustainable approach to lawn care.

Quick-release fertilizers provide an immediate burst of nutrients to the lawn. This can result in a rapid green-up, but it also carries a higher risk of burning the grass if applied improperly. Quick-release fertilizers are typically less expensive than slow-release fertilizers, but they require more frequent applications and careful attention to application rates.

Organic fertilizers are derived from natural sources, such as compost, manure, and bone meal. They release nutrients slowly and improve soil health over time. Organic fertilizers are environmentally friendly and can enhance the overall ecosystem of your lawn. However, they may require more time to produce noticeable results compared to synthetic fertilizers.

Synthetic fertilizers are manufactured chemically and provide a concentrated dose of nutrients to the lawn. They are typically less expensive than organic fertilizers and can produce rapid results. However, synthetic fertilizers can be harsh on the environment and may contribute to soil degradation over time if used improperly.

Liquid fertilizers are applied as a spray and are quickly absorbed by the lawn. They are ideal for providing a rapid boost of nutrients, but they require frequent applications and can be more expensive than granular fertilizers. Liquid fertilizers are also useful for delivering micronutrients and other specialized treatments directly to the lawn.

Granular fertilizers are applied using a spreader and release nutrients gradually over time. They are a convenient and cost-effective option for most homeowners. Granular fertilizers are available in both slow-release and quick-release formulations, offering flexibility to suit different needs.

Application Tips for Spring Lawn Fertilization

Proper application is just as important as choosing the right fertilizer. Follow these tips to ensure that you achieve the best possible results from your spring fertilization efforts.

Always read and follow the instructions on the fertilizer bag carefully. Over-application can burn the grass, while under-application may not provide enough nutrients to promote healthy growth. Pay close attention to the recommended application rates and adjust accordingly based on the size of your lawn.

Use a spreader to apply granular fertilizer evenly across the lawn. Calibrate the spreader to the correct setting to ensure that you are applying the fertilizer at the recommended rate. Walk at a consistent pace and overlap each pass slightly to avoid gaps in coverage.

Water the lawn thoroughly after applying fertilizer. This helps to dissolve the fertilizer granules and move the nutrients into the soil where they can be absorbed by the grass roots. Watering also helps to prevent fertilizer burn.

Avoid applying fertilizer during hot, dry weather. The risk of burning the grass is higher when the lawn is stressed by heat and drought. Instead, fertilize in the early morning or late evening when temperatures are cooler.

Do not apply fertilizer to wet grass. This can cause the fertilizer granules to stick to the blades of grass, increasing the risk of burning. Wait until the grass is dry before applying fertilizer.

Consider using a drop spreader for precise application along edges and around obstacles. Drop spreaders release fertilizer directly onto the ground, minimizing the risk of spreading fertilizer onto sidewalks or driveways.

Clean up any spilled fertilizer immediately. Sweep or vacuum up any granules that have landed on hard surfaces to prevent them from being washed into storm drains or waterways.

Addressing Common Lawn Problems in Spring

Spring can bring its own set of challenges for lawns. Addressing these problems proactively will help you maintain a healthy and vibrant lawn throughout the growing season.

Weed control is a common concern in spring. Applying a pre-emergent herbicide in early spring can prevent weed seeds from germinating. Alternatively, you can spot-treat weeds with a post-emergent herbicide as they appear. Be sure to choose a herbicide that is appropriate for your type of grass and follow the instructions carefully.

Crabgrass is a particularly troublesome weed that often emerges in spring. Pre-emergent herbicides specifically designed for crabgrass control can be highly effective in preventing its growth.

Grubs are the larvae of beetles that feed on grass roots. If you have a history of grub infestations, consider applying a preventative insecticide in spring. Look for signs of grub damage, such as brown patches of grass that can be easily pulled up.

Lawn diseases can also be a problem in spring, especially in humid climates. Proper fertilization, watering, and mowing practices can help to prevent lawn diseases. If you notice signs of disease, such as spots or lesions on the grass blades, consider applying a fungicide.

Thatch is a layer of dead organic matter that accumulates on the surface of the soil. Excessive thatch can prevent water and nutrients from reaching the grass roots. Dethatching your lawn in spring can help to improve its health and vigor.

Aeration is the process of creating small holes in the soil to improve air circulation and drainage. Aerating your lawn in spring can help to alleviate soil compaction and promote root growth.

What are the key nutrients I should look for in a spring lawn fertilizer?

A spring lawn fertilizer should primarily focus on nitrogen (N), phosphorus (P), and potassium (K), often represented as N-P-K on the fertilizer bag. Nitrogen promotes rapid green growth, which is essential for recovering from winter dormancy. Phosphorus is important for root development, helping your lawn establish a strong foundation. Potassium contributes to overall plant health and disease resistance, preparing your lawn for the stresses of summer.

Look for a fertilizer with a higher nitrogen number relative to phosphorus and potassium for spring. For example, a 24-0-4 fertilizer would be suitable. Consider your soil test results if you have them. If your soil is already rich in phosphorus, you might choose a fertilizer with a 24-0-8 ratio or similar, avoiding excess phosphorus runoff which can harm waterways.

What is the difference between slow-release and quick-release fertilizers, and which is better for spring?

Quick-release fertilizers provide nutrients immediately, resulting in a rapid green-up of your lawn. They are typically water-soluble and release their nutrients when watered or after rainfall. This rapid release can be beneficial for lawns that need a quick boost after winter, but the effects are short-lived, and they can also lead to fertilizer burn if overapplied.

Slow-release fertilizers, on the other hand, release nutrients gradually over a longer period, often weeks or months. This provides a more consistent and sustained feeding, reducing the risk of burning and promoting even growth. For spring, a slow-release fertilizer is generally recommended, as it supports healthy and consistent growth as the lawn wakes up from dormancy. Look for fertilizers containing water-insoluble nitrogen (WIN) for slow-release benefits.

What are the potential risks of over-fertilizing my lawn?

Over-fertilizing can lead to several problems for your lawn and the environment. The most immediate risk is fertilizer burn, which appears as yellow or brown patches of dead grass. This occurs when excess fertilizer draws water out of the grass blades, essentially dehydrating them. Over-fertilization also weakens the grass, making it more susceptible to diseases and pests.

Beyond your lawn, excess fertilizer can leach into the groundwater or run off into nearby bodies of water. This runoff can pollute waterways, causing algal blooms that deplete oxygen and harm aquatic life. Using too much nitrogen can also lead to excessive thatch buildup, creating a breeding ground for pests and diseases. Always follow the recommended application rates on the fertilizer label to avoid these issues.

How often should I fertilize my lawn in the spring?

The frequency of fertilization in the spring depends on several factors, including the type of fertilizer you’re using (quick-release or slow-release), the type of grass you have, and your desired level of lawn care intensity. Generally, a single application of a slow-release fertilizer in early to mid-spring is sufficient for most lawns. This provides a sustained feeding as the grass actively grows.

If you’re using a quick-release fertilizer, you may need to apply it more frequently, perhaps every 4-6 weeks. However, be cautious not to over-fertilize, as this can harm your lawn. Monitor your lawn’s growth and color to determine if additional fertilization is needed. A healthy, green lawn is a good indicator that your fertilization schedule is adequate. Always err on the side of caution and avoid over-fertilizing.
